This print captures the essence of ancient Mayan civilization during the Late Classic Period. The artwork, titled "Two seated men, El Chicozapote, Usumacinta" showcases a remarkable stucco and paint sculpture created between 600-900 AD. Displayed in the Museo Amparo in Puebla, Mexico, this Mexican masterpiece is an extraordinary representation of Mesoamerican art. The mural's vibrant colors and intricate details transport viewers back to a time when Teotihuacan culture flourished. The two men depicted in the relief sculpture sit cross-legged with their legs elegantly crossed. Their profiles are adorned with elaborate headdresses and hats that symbolize their status within society. As they face each other, there is an undeniable sense of connection and interaction between them. The polychrome nature of this piece adds to its allure as it radiates brightness and vitality even after centuries have passed. This pre-Columbian artifact serves as a testament to the artistic prowess and cultural significance of the Maya civilization.
